Conozca la nueva potente herramienta de IBM: Qiskit. Es su caja de herramientas, su navaja suiza, su sombrero de vaquero cuántico, todo en uno.
Con Qiskit, no sólo estás jugando con los circuitos; estás montando la onda cuántica, diseñando algoritmos alucinantes y superando los límites de lo que es posible en el universo cuántico.
¿Suena bien? Mirémoslo más de cerca y descubramos de qué es capaz.
Explicación del bombo Qiskit de IBM
Qiskit, desarrollado por IBM, es un kit de desarrollo de software (SDK) de computación cuántica que sirve como un conjunto de herramientas integral para investigadores, desarrolladores y entusiastas interesados en explorar la computación cuántica. Lanzado en 2017, Qiskit ha evolucionado a lo largo de los años hasta convertirse en una de las plataformas de código abierto más utilizadas en la comunidad de computación cuántica.

Básicamente, Qiskit proporciona un conjunto de herramientas y bibliotecas para crear, simular y ejecutar circuitos cuánticos. Estos circuitos, compuestos por puertas cuánticas, representan los componentes fundamentales de los algoritmos y aplicaciones cuánticos. Con Qiskit, los usuarios pueden diseñar algoritmos cuánticos personalizados, simular su comportamiento en computadoras clásicas y ejecutarlos en el hardware cuántico de IBM a través del acceso a la nube.
Una de las características notables de Qiskit es su servicio Transpiler, que optimiza los circuitos cuánticos para una ejecución eficiente en los procesadores cuánticos de IBM. Al aprovechar las técnicas de inteligencia artificial, como el aprendizaje automático, el servicio Transpiler tiene como objetivo minimizar la profundidad del circuito y reducir la cantidad de puertas cuánticas, mejorando así el rendimiento general.
Además, Qiskit ofrece un servicio Runtime para ejecutar programas cuánticos de forma escalable y eficiente. Este servicio agiliza el proceso de ejecución de algoritmos cuánticos en los sistemas cuánticos de IBM y proporciona técnicas avanzadas de mitigación de errores para mejorar la confiabilidad de los resultados.
Qiskit también incluye un asistente de código, impulsado por modelos generativos de IA, para ayudar a los usuarios a escribir y optimizar código cuántico. Integrado en entornos de desarrollo populares como Visual Studio Code y Jupyter Lab, Code Assistant tiene como objetivo simplificar el flujo de trabajo de programación cuántica y mejorar la productividad.
Además, Qiskit Serverless permite a los usuarios implementar y gestionar cargas de trabajo centradas en lo cuántico en hardware cuántico y clústeres clásicos. Esta característica abstrae las complejidades del aprovisionamiento de recursos y la orquestación de cargas de trabajo, lo que facilita a los usuarios escalar sus cálculos cuánticos e integrarlos en las infraestructuras de TI existentes.
De cara al futuro, IBM continúa invirtiendo en el desarrollo de Qiskit, con planes de introducir nuevas características y mejoras en el futuro. A medida que la tecnología de la computación cuántica madura y se vuelve más accesible, Qiskit permanece a la vanguardia, permitiendo a los usuarios explorar el potencial de la computación cuántica e impulsar la innovación en diversos campos.
Crédito de la imagen destacada: IBM
Source: Presentación de Qiskit: el conjunto de herramientas de IBM para los pioneros cuánticos





